Transaction 59e6bf514539e716e61ebc1133b44dd8103764b0a6a8599975c0586b73524b09

2 Input
2 Outputs
  • 59e6bf514539e716e61ebc1133b44dd8103764b0a6a8599975c0586b73524b09:0
  • value  1360682
    address  3FCeXRwffYgtvUawXKmGgt6KdKWByQAJjF
  • 59e6bf514539e716e61ebc1133b44dd8103764b0a6a8599975c0586b73524b09:1
  • value  353667
    address  bc1qfrxd4wyuyv47yzc4kj7xyqgl3sraavfk30n53m